The Sacred Origins of Badrinath Temple

The Badrinath Temple, often referred to as the ‘Temple of Bliss,’ is a renowned Hindu temple situated in the Himalayan town of Badrinath. It is one of the four holy sites related to the god Vishnu, making it a significant destination for devotees. According to scriptures, the temple was initially constructed by Prahlada, the son of Hiranyakashipu, under the guidance of Narada Muni.

How to Reach Badrinath

Reaching Badrinath is an adventure in itself, offering a picturesque journey through the Himalayan landscape. The nearest railway station is Rishikesh, located about 295 kilometers away. Rishikesh is well-connected by the Indian railway network with major destinations across the country. From Rishikesh, one can take a motorable road to reach Badrinath, with frequent trains running to Rishikesh daily.

Significance of the Temple

Badrinath Temple holds immense spiritual value for Hindus worldwide. It is believed that a visit to this temple purifies the soul and brings one closer to attaining moksha, or liberation. Being one of the Char Dham, the temple not only attracts thousands of pilgrims each year but also serves as a testament to the rich cultural and spiritual heritage of India.
